TODAY’S 5 VOCABULARY WORDS

1 | Empathy

  • Part of speech: Noun

  • Definition: The ability to understand and share the feelings of another person.

  • Example Sentences:

    1. Developing empathy is crucial for navigating cultural differences effectively.

    2. By showing empathy, you can build stronger relationships with people from diverse backgrounds.

    3. Her heartfelt understanding demonstrated her genuine empathy for the situation.

2 | Ethnocentrism

  • Part of speech: Noun

  • Definition: The belief that one's own culture is superior to others.

  • Example Sentences:

    1. Recognizing and challenging your own ethnocentric biases fosters respectful and inclusive communication.

    2. Overcoming ethnocentrism opens you to appreciating diverse cultural perspectives and values.

    3. Intercultural communication skills encourage empathy and understanding, moving beyond ethnocentric viewpoints.

3 | Humility

  • Part of speech: Noun

  • Definition: The quality of being modest and having a realistic view of one's own importance.

  • Example Sentences:

    1. Approaching intercultural communication with humility allows you to learn from others and be open to different perspectives.

    2. Recognizing you don't have all the answers is a sign of humility and opens you to valuable cultural insights.

    3. Intercultural communication skills are enhanced by humility, which fosters open-mindedness and respectful learning.

4 | Cultural context

  • Part of speech: Noun

  • Definition: The background, social customs, and beliefs that inform a particular culture.

  • Example Sentences:

    1. Understanding cultural context adds depth and meaning to communication and helps avoid misinterpretations.

    2. Considering the historical and social cultural context allows you to appreciate different viewpoints.

    3. Intercultural communication skills empower you to analyze cultural context and communicate effectively.

5 | Intercultural competence

  • Part of speech: Noun

  • Definition: The ability to communicate and interact effectively with people from different cultures.

  • Example Sentences:

    1. Developing intercultural competence takes time and effort but leads to richer and more meaningful interactions.

    2. Learning about different cultures, practicing language skills, and being open to new experiences contribute to intercultural competence.

    3. Investing in intercultural competence unlocks a world of opportunities for understanding, connection, and collaboration.

A PARAGRAPH USING THE 5 VOCABULARY WORDS

Navigating diverse cultures requires more than just language fluency. It's about understanding the invisible layers of cultural context, where gestures, humor, and even personal space. hold different meanings. We must ditch ethnocentrism, the belief our own culture reigns supreme, and embrace humility. Only then can we truly listen with empathy, seeking to understand experiences and emotions from different perspectives. By appreciating the nuances of each culture, we unlock the magic of meaningful connections, where communication transcends mere words and fosters genuine understanding. This journey might involve misinterpretations and awkward moments, but with each interaction, our intercultural competence blossoms, enriching our lives and paving the way for a more connected world.
